Abstract

The utility model discloses a modularization hand trip peripheral hardware, include as basic module's shell key module, the pulse module and bluetooth module, the battery module and the support module etc. whether optional configuration of shell key module cooperation use. The physical key is adopted, so that better touch and feedback can be provided, and better game experience is provided; the keys and the mobile phone protective shell are integrated together to form the shell key module, so that the functions of the mobile phone protective shell are retained, the thickness and the weight of the protective shell are not increased, and the keys are placed on the left and right corners, so that the operation habits of holding and playing of the mobile phone are better met; moreover, the shell key module with the modular design is used as a basic module, and one of the pulse module and the Bluetooth module is combined with the shell key module for use, so that the installation is convenient and the use is flexible; and, the shell key module of modular design offers more kinds of possibilities for the peripheral hardware of the hand trip.

Technical Field
The utility model relates to a cell-phone accessory technical field, concretely relates to modularization hand trip peripheral hardware.
Background
The hand game is divided into a leisure intelligence development class, an operation strategy class, a sports competition class, a chess and card table game class, an action shooting class, a role playing class and the like, and has strong entertainment and interactivity. Generally, the operation keys of the mobile game are designed in a mobile game program and then displayed on a touch screen so that people can touch and control the game, and due to the lack of key feedback feeling of physical keys, the playing and control feeling of many games is relatively poor, so that a mobile game peripheral (short for external equipment) appears. The existing mobile game peripherals have various types and have the main defects of heaviness, inconvenient installation, use and carrying and poor matching with the mobile phone. There is a need for a lightweight, compact, modular, portable, and easily assembled, novel handheld peripheral.

Detailed Description
The present invention is described in terms of specific embodiments, and other advantages and benefits of the present invention will become apparent to those skilled in the art from the following disclosure. Based on the embodiments in the present invention, all other embodiments obtained by a person skilled in the art without creative work belong to the protection scope of the present invention.
In the present invention, the terms "upper", "lower", "left", "right", "middle", and the like are used for clarity of description, and are not intended to limit the scope of the present invention, and changes or adjustments of the relative relationship thereof without substantial changes in the technical content are also regarded as the scope of the present invention.
As shown in fig. 1 to 8, the present embodiment provides a modular peripheral for a mobile game, which includes a case key module 10 as a base module, a pulse module 20 and a bluetooth module 30 alternatively used with the case key module 10, a battery module and a rack module which can be configured or not, and the like.
The shell key module 10 includes a mobile phone protection shell 11, a key 12, a first contact 13 (e.g., a female contact), and a first magnetic conductive sheet 14. The keys 12 are arranged in two groups and are respectively arranged at two ends of the long edge of the mobile phone protective shell 11, so that when the hand shaking machine is held on a transverse screen, fingers (generally index fingers) can touch the hand shaking machine more conveniently. The first contact 13 is disposed on the back of the mobile phone case 11. The key 12 is connected to the first contact 13 through a circuit internally disposed in the mobile phone protective case 11 (for example, the mobile phone protective case 11 includes an inner case 111 and an outer case 112, the outer case 112 is sleeved outside the inner case 111, and a circuit between the key 12 and the first contact 13 is located between the outer case 112 and the inner case 111. it should be noted that the key 12 is a light-touch membrane switch and is mounted in a groove on the inner case 111, the circuit is a flexible circuit and connects the first contact and the key to form a switch circuit, although the circuit is divided into the inner case 111 and the outer case 112, the overall thickness of the case is not increased to avoid a sense of bulkiness), and the key 12 controls the on/off of the circuit (in general, each key 12 corresponds to a circuit, the circuit is off, and after the key 12 is pressed, the circuit is closed, and the key 12 corresponds to a press switch). The inner shell 111 of the mobile phone protective shell is provided with a groove corresponding to the position of the key 12, a raised cylindrical key cap column 113 and a positioning column 114 are arranged in the groove, and the key 12 is reversely arranged in the groove. The first magnetic conductive sheets 14 are multiple, and the multiple first magnetic conductive sheets 14 are respectively arranged on the back and the side of the mobile phone protection shell 11 and are used for being fixed with the pulse module 20, the bluetooth module 30, the battery module or the bracket module in a magnetic attraction manner. Optionally, a folding support is arranged on the back of the mobile phone protection shell 11, and the mobile phone can be supported to be placed when the mobile phone protection shell is opened. Preferably, the back of the mobile phone protecting shell 11 is provided with a support module fixed by magnetic attraction, the support module includes a folding circular support and a fourth magnet fixed on one side of the folding circular support, and when the support module is fixed on the back of the shell key module, the fourth magnet is attracted to the first magnetic conductive sheet 14.
The pulse module 20 includes a pulse housing 21, a first battery 22, a pulse control board 23, a second contact 24 (e.g., a male contact), a third contact 25 (e.g., a conductive film), and a first magnet. The pulse module 20 is U-shaped; preferably, the pulse housing 21 includes a lower housing 211 and an upper housing 212, both the lower housing 211 and the upper housing 212 are L-shaped, the short sides of the lower housing 211 and the upper housing 212 are coupled through a rotating shaft 213, and the coupling has a certain friction force or a restoring spring (for example, a torsion spring, which makes the lower housing 211 and the upper housing 212 in a state of tending to be clamped), so that the third contact 25 can be adjusted to make the third contact 25 tightly contact with the mobile phone screen. The first battery 22 and the pulse control board 23 are arranged in the pulse shell 21, the second contact 24 and the third contact 25 are arranged outside the pulse shell 21, the orientations of the second contact 24 and the third contact 25 are opposite, and the pulse control board 23 is electrically connected with the battery, the second contact 24 and the third contact 25. The first magnets are provided in plurality, are disposed outside the pulse shell 21, and correspond to the first magnetic conductive sheet 14. When the pulse module 20 is fixed on the side of the shell key module 10 by magnetic attraction, the second contact 24 is in contact with and conducted with the first contact 13, the third contact 25 abuts against the mobile phone screen, and at the moment, when the key 12 is pressed down, the charge on the third contact 25 changes, so that the effect of clicking or touching the mobile phone screen is achieved.
The bluetooth module 30 includes a bluetooth case 31, a second battery 32, a bluetooth control board 33, a fourth contact 34 (e.g., a male contact), and a second magnet 35. The battery and the bluetooth control board 33 are both provided in the bluetooth case 31. A fourth contact 34 is provided on one side of the bluetooth shell 31. The second magnet 35 is hidden from view on the side of the blue tooth case 31 having the fourth contact 34. The bluetooth control board 33 is electrically connected with the second battery 32 and the fourth contact 34, and the bluetooth control board 33 can be wirelessly connected with the mobile phone. The back of the mobile phone protection shell 11 is hidden with a first magnetic conductive sheet 14. When the bluetooth module 30 is magnetically attracted and fixed to the back of the shell key module 10, the second magnet 35 is attracted to the first magnetic conductive sheet 14 on the back of the mobile phone protection shell 11; meanwhile, the fourth contact 34 is in contact conduction with the first contact 13, the key 12 is pressed at the moment, and an electric signal is sent to the mobile phone through the Bluetooth control board 33 to simulate touch. Optionally, a circular folding bracket 36 is arranged on the back of the bluetooth shell 31, and the mobile phone can be supported when the bracket 36 is opened.
The battery module is an optional module and comprises a battery shell, a third battery, a wireless charging module, a third magnet and a second magnetic conductive sheet. The third battery and the wireless charging module are arranged in the battery shell. The third battery is electrically connected with the wireless charging module. The third magnet is hidden and arranged on one side of the battery shell, and the second magnetic conductive sheet is hidden and arranged on the other side of the battery shell. When the battery module is magnetically fixed on the back of the shell key module 10, the third magnet is attracted with the first magnetic conductive sheet 14, and the mobile phone is charged through the wireless charging module; when the battery module is located between the shell key module 10 and the bluetooth module 30, the third magnet is attracted to the first magnetic conductive sheet 14, and the second magnet 35 is attracted to the second magnetic conductive sheet, so that the mobile phone can be charged and the bluetooth module 30 can be used.
